Come and explore the entire complex of the Dome of Florence on a private guided tour. Learn the history of the Dome and Duomo Complex, by visiting the Opera del Duomo Museum, Baptistery and the Crypt of Santa Reparata. Without Brunelleschi's Dome and Giotto's Bell Tower climbs, this tour will be much more interesting and less strenuous. Through this private tour, you will be able to admire the Opera del Duomo Museum, which inside it contains the original doors of the Baptistery (including the door of paradise/golden door), the original statues of the Cathedral and the Bell Tower, such as Michelangelo's Pietà and Donatello's Maddalena. After visiting the museum, you will visit the Baptistery of San Giovanni, one of the oldest buildings in Florence that still exists. Consecrated in 1059, it was dedicated to San Giovanni Battista, patron saint of Florence. Many Florentines were baptized there, including Dante Alighieri, the most famous Italian poet and father of the Italian language. The dome and apse of the Baptistery are decorated with splendid religious mosaics with a golden background.
